This vast museum complex houses some of the country's finest historical treasures, including vintage vehicles, antique machinery and iconic pieces of furniture.
Discover Thomas Edison’s Menlo Park, where Abraham Lincoln practiced law and learn about how Henry Ford revolutionized manufacturing at this historic village.

The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 21°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of -1°C. The snowiest months in Plymouth are January, November, February and March, with each month seeing an average of 13 cm of snowfall.
